Yeah I guess that is more in character with Grunt, but I feel like he sort of got forgotten. I sort of see a side of him that may be an officer. I'm just wondering how different he would be if he were to become an officer. But considering he got an Engineering degree, maybe he'd be in the lab with Matt Trakker and Gears, and Brainstorm. There are a few Joes that are College Grads that didn't do the officer route. Mainframe I can see since he's older and doesn't care about being an Officer. Scoop? Not sure.
He would probably have gone combat Engineers or gone back to the Infantry. He would have probably opted to get his Ranger Tab. I don't see him going Combat Support or Combat Service Support. He's an Infantryman. He might have gone Engineers and gotten command of a Sapper Platoon or something. Those Combat Engineers are pretty tough and they work hand in hand with the Infantry, and Combat Engineer officers can still go to Ranger School.

The SF Warrant Officer was formalised in the early 1980s. The following document gives a pretty thorough historical background on the specialisation:
http://www.usawoa.org/woheritage/Hist_SF_WO.pdf The short summary is basically this: Special Forces needed detachment XOs, but finding lieutenants that had the necessary experience to serve as SF executive officers was hard. Most infantry lieutenants were too young and inexperienced to serve meaningfully in the SF XO role. Special Operations Command initially floated the idea of creating a limited-duty officer program (similar to what the Navy and the Marines have) exclusively for senior SF NCOs, but eventually settled on working in these NCOs within existing warrant officer structure. Lieutenant have never worked very well in SF. In Vietnam, Butter Bar Green Berets made a lot of mistakes and got a lot of guys killed. Since the early 80's, the earliest an officer can apply for SF is as a First LT who is already on the Promotion list for Captain, and those are very rare. As a general rule, only Captains apply for SF. So the Teams needed an XO, and they needed the XO to be an officer... why? Simple, because Green Berets work with indiginous military forces all the time, especially in South America (in the 80's). And in working with Spanish speaking armies, Rank is very important... it's cultural. So let's say that a Green Beret A-Team arrives in Coloumbia or Panama and needs to work with the local army on counter narcotics operations which will include training local forces. This will mean that the Captian and the XO will need to give a lot of briefings and blocks of instructions to the Columbian/Panamainian Officers and commanders. And the bottom line is: NO Spanish speaking officer is taking any suggestions/instructions from an enlisted soldier. It's simply not happening. It's a class issue. This is also sometimes an issue when SF has to deal with our own conventional forces. Let's say SF has been in country for several monthes and now the conventional forces are showing up to reinforce or take over an AO (area of operation). This happened all the time in Afghanistan early in the War. Now, obviously SF knows what's up and are the experts. However, most conventional (Infantry) Battalion Commanders (or higher) or going to take orders/suggestions from an NCO. Just not going to happen. It's a class/respect issue. So, by creating the Warrant Officer position within SF, it gives experienced NCO's with leadership potential and opportunity to be commisioned and much more "respectable" when talking with other officers from outside SF. Within the Group, everyone knows who is in charge, but regardless of rank, people with expertise and intelligence are respected and listened to. I was told this story: An SF Team XL from 7th group was briefing a General in Panama. Prior to the meeting, he switched rank with his Team Leader so he wore Captain's bars for the briefing. He needed them to listen, and he new they would listen to a Captain. After the briefing, he went back outside, put on his correct ranks, and got back to work. Because SF Teams often split into 2 teams (they're designed to be able to do this), it was determined that it's best to have at least 1 Officer in each team because, concievably, each team would have to work with different indiginous groups, or conventional forces.
